Ceisteanna Eile - Other Questions: Mental Health Services (20 Apr 2023)

Mark Ward: Since the Maskey report was published, the emphasis has been on Kerry, and rightly so, given the chronic mistreatment of children there. Deputy Funchion cited figures from February but they have increased again since March. I have figures to hand that show the national figures in CAMHS increased by a further 3% between February and March. A total of 4,434 children are waiting for a first...

Vacant Homes Tax: Motion [Private Members] (19 Apr 2023)

Mark Ward: I listened to the Minister on the radio this morning talking about the forecasted budgetary surplus. He had a caveat that forecasts can be unreliable and that we need to be cautious, and rightly so. Census figures are not forecasts, however; they are factually correct. The figures from the census in 2022 show that there were 160,000 vacant properties. Some 48,000 of these were vacant in...

Ceisteanna ar Sonraíodh Uain Dóibh - Priority Questions: Drug Dealing (18 Apr 2023)

Mark Ward: A young person who is taking nitrous oxide is playing Russian roulette because they do not know the effects the gas will have on them until they take it. There have been reports from medical experts of the adverse side effects. What laws are in place to seize nitrous oxide canisters that are being misused and what are the penalties for those illegally distributing them?

Ceisteanna ar Sonraíodh Uain Dóibh - Priority Questions: Drug Dealing (18 Apr 2023)

Mark Ward: I thank the Minister for that comprehensive answer in relation to the Act but why is it not being used at the moment? You only have to walk into any housing estate or any park and you will see discarded nitrous oxide canisters lying around. It is commonly know as laughing gas. When it first came out it was in small silver bullets and was called one hit wonders. It has been replaced by...
